Weiter zum Inhalt

Blockly

6.6k Themen 79.8k Beiträge

Hilfe für Skripterstellung mit Blockly

NEWS

  • Mit Blockly JSON aus Liste erstellen

    6
    1
    0 Stimmen
    6 Beiträge
    716 Aufrufe
    mickymM
    @chris76e OK ich konnte das nicht erkennen - ob Objekt oder JSON string - bin aber davon ausgegangen, dass Du beides entsprechend nach Bedarf aus dem Objekt bzw. umgekehrt erzeugen kannst. Ich halte es in jedem Fall einfacher, als über Schleifen, was zusammen zu basteln. Im Prinzip hättest Du Deine Strings auch nur in eine Liste überführen müssen. Da hättest ja nur die Liste bei jedem Schleifendurchlauf um den String erweitern müssen. Aber wie gesagt ich mag das Blockly eh nicht - mir ging es nur mal darum zu sehen, wie JSONATA in Blockly funktioniert und das ihr "Blocklies" durchaus auch Interesse an JSONATA haben könnt. ;) Ist doch trotzdem wesentlich einfacher als Deine Schleife.
  • [gelöst] Frage zu Baustein Trigger - Objekt ID

    2
    1
    0 Stimmen
    2 Beiträge
    118 Aufrufe
    paul53P
    @david-g sagte: Beziehen sich diese Werte "nur" auf den Moment in dem der Trigger ausgelöst hat Ja. Bei einem Test funktioniert es so (debug gegen telegram austauschen): [image: 1662900821601-bild_2022-09-11_145341253.png] Anmerkung: Das Stoppen des Intervalls außerhalb des Triggers ist unnötig.
  • Verschachtelung von Bedingunen im Blockly nötig?

    10
    1
    0 Stimmen
    10 Beiträge
    813 Aufrufe
    paul53P
    @clixmaster sagte: Gibt es da noch Verbesserungspotenzial? Ja. Erstelle für jede Heizung einen 2-Punkt-Regler mit Hysterese und verwende die PV-Auswertung als Regler-Freigabe (Variable). Es können gleichzeitig alle 4 Heizungen laufen, unabhängig von der Höhe des PV-Überschusses. Soll das so sein? Haben alle 4 Heizungen die gleiche Leistung? Beispiel für 2-Punkt-Regler Bad: [image: 1662890150152-bild_2022-09-11_115549690.png]
  • [Gelöst] Attribut X vom Objekt Y Block

    10
    2
    0 Stimmen
    10 Beiträge
    3k Aufrufe
    O
    @paul53 sagte in [Gelöst] Attribut X vom Objekt Y Block: Perfekt, vielen Dank!
  • Batteriestatus Abfrage Name wird nicht angezeigt

    8
    1
    0 Stimmen
    8 Beiträge
    609 Aufrufe
    T
    @lessthanmore sagte in Batteriestatus Abfrage Name wird nicht angezeigt: @torsten_mg Nutzt du den Zigbee Adapter? Bei mir läuft es mit „Kanalname“. In deinem Screenshot ist aber keinem DP die Funktion „battery_status“ zugewiesen. Habe mich auch schon gewundert und gefunden. "battery_status" kommt von den Tado Geräten. Habe diese jetzt mal aus der Aufzählung rausgenommen und die Bedingung für Wenn angepasst. Jetzt werden mir auch die Richtigen Texte Angezeigt. Was da genau schief gelaufen ist, verstehe ich nicht.
  • blockly exec scrot

    15
    0 Stimmen
    15 Beiträge
    983 Aufrufe
    S
    @bananajoe Danke für diese einfache, aber gute Idee! Per Cron-Job funktioniert Scrot und ich kann mir nach Bedarf per Telegram den letzten Screenshot zuschicken lassen. Das reicht mir so vollkommen! DANKE!!!
  • Überprüfen, ob alle Objekte in einem Ordner gleich

    3
    0 Stimmen
    3 Beiträge
    128 Aufrufe
    G
    @paul53 vielen Dank für die Hilfe!
  • Brauche Hilfe zu async/await

    5
    1
    0 Stimmen
    5 Beiträge
    387 Aufrufe
    R
    @asgothian Danke Dir, sollte dann auch bei meinen Kenntnissen reichen, das umzusetzen. Außerdem glaube ich, ich habe falsch rum gedacht und es ist viel einfacher, das umzusetzen, was ich möchte. Wenn das Setzen von 'StandBy' auf true schon nach sich zieht, dass 'StandbyValue' von 0 auf 'x' Stunden geändert wird, kann ich ja 'StandByValue' als Trigger für diesen Modus hernehmen, nicht 'Standby'. Die Anlage zählt ja nach 'StandBy' = true ihre x Stunden runter, bis sie den Leckageschutz wieder anschaltet. Ich kann dann ja 'StandbyValue' im Script als Trigger her nehmen, ggf. 'sicherheitshalber' nochmal nachfragen ob 'Standby' auch true ist, und dann einen Timer mit der gleichen Zeit/Dauer setzen, der in der VIS angezeigt wird und herunterzählt. Danach beendet die Anlage eh von selbst diesen Modus, und auch die beiden DP's gehen wieder auf ihre vorherigen Werte ('false' und '0' (h)).
  • [gelöst] Blockly Zugriff auf Fileserver (Samba ohne Auth)

    8
    0 Stimmen
    8 Beiträge
    292 Aufrufe
    DJMarc75D
    @thomas-braun sagte in Blockly Zugriff auf Fileserver (Samba ohne Auth): /media ist dafür vorgesehen erledigt und @thomas-braun sagte in Blockly Zugriff auf Fileserver (Samba ohne Auth): leg dir user dafür an Hab eben auf dem Fileserver einen Samba-user mit PW angelegt !
  • FSB14 Status anzeigen bzw. Zwischenpositionen anfahren

    2
    0 Stimmen
    2 Beiträge
    120 Aufrufe
    G
    @maik2012 Hallo Maik, falls Du das geschafft hast, waere es schoen, wenn Du die Loesung hier posten koenntest, ich haenge da gerade auch fest.
  • [Gelöst] Rollosteuerung nach Windrichtung/Regenmenge

    3
    2
    0 Stimmen
    3 Beiträge
    145 Aufrufe
    H
    @paul53 vielen Dank für die schnelle Antwort! Werd ich morgen gleich ausprobieren.
  • [Gelöst] Lichtsteuerung mit Aldi-Fernbed. (Megos) - Dimmen

    blockly
    13
    4
    0 Stimmen
    13 Beiträge
    1k Aufrufe
    AsgothianA
    @kuehni84 sagte in [Gelöst] Lichtsteuerung mit Aldi-Fernbed. (Megos) - Dimmen: Also der Conbee Stick ist für mich Geschichte. Habe mit heute den Sonoff USB Dongle Plus bestellt. Du kannst den Conbee durchaus mit dem Zigbee Adapter nutzen sofern es stimmt das Dresden-elektronik die Geräteunterstützung auch über die Community aktuell eingestellt hat. Die Unterstützung des Conbee im Zigbee Adapter ist von der Unterstützung in der Phoscon software unabhängig. A.
  • gelöst Blokly Fehlermeldung Firefox

    1
    1
    0 Stimmen
    1 Beiträge
    84 Aufrufe
    Niemand hat geantwortet
  • Blocky erstelle Text mir 3 Zeilen

    2
    0 Stimmen
    2 Beiträge
    297 Aufrufe
    DJMarc75D
    @sectorchan [image: 1662404390356-screenshot-2022-09-05-205934.png] links das "Element" anpacken und nach rechts ziehen.
  • Google home im Bad

    8
    0 Stimmen
    8 Beiträge
    252 Aufrufe
    Horst BöttcherH
    @glasfaser wird alles eingetragen ich glaub es liegt am chromecast Adapter das es,nicht geht
  • Wie lange keine Wertveränderung

    5
    0 Stimmen
    5 Beiträge
    424 Aufrufe
    paul53P
    @mathopa1973 sagte: Wert sich ja in dem Moment eben nicht verändert und der Logik nach der Block nicht auszuführen wäre? Die Ausführung findet 30 s nach der letzten Wertänderung statt, wenn nicht vorher der Timer durch eine neue Wertänderung gestoppt und neu gestartet wurde.
  • Werte von Durchflussmesser l/h umrechnen in Verbrauchswert

    8
    0 Stimmen
    8 Beiträge
    728 Aufrufe
    V
    @paul53 Habe es hinbekommen. Nochmals vielen Dank!!
  • Curl befehl mit Blockly ausführen? Gelöst

    3
    0 Stimmen
    3 Beiträge
    327 Aufrufe
    W
    @meister-mopp Super danke hatte es zwar schon so probiert und hat nicht funktioniert aber nach deiner Antwort nochmal probiert und es geht.
  • Automatische Abschaltung per Shelly

    7
    1
    0 Stimmen
    7 Beiträge
    2k Aufrufe
    OstfrieseUnterwegsO
    Ich hab mich von Anfang an entschieden, alles in ioB zu machen und keinerlei Funktionen der Geräte selber zu nutzen (sehr selten lässt es sich nicht vermeiden). Wenn Du ein AutoTimerOff des Shelly selber nutzt, dann fragst Du Dich eventuell in einem halben Jahr Warum zum Teufel schaltet das Ding immer aus? Wenn man nur ein paar Geräte hat, mag man das noch im Kopf haben aber wenn es mehr werden, dann nicht. Shellys haben diese Funktion eingebaut, andere Geräte nicht. Dann hast Du es manchmal im Gerät und manchmal in ioB. Das wird ein Durcheinander, was ich zumindest gerne vermeiden will. Einmal eine Strategie festlegen und dabei bleiben. Wenn man sie ändern möchte, dann konsequent alles nachziehen. Das hab ich z.B vor längerer Zeit gemacht und alles(!) auf Alias umgestellt.
  • Verstehe die Fehlermeldung nicht

    18
    0 Stimmen
    18 Beiträge
    1k Aufrufe
    M
    Danke schön @ciddi89 und @paul53, jetzt tut´s

535

Online

32.8k

Benutzer

82.9k

Themen

1.3m

Beiträge